What does it take to be successful in this role?
Sound knowledge about SmartCOMM Modules - Data Modeler, Advanced Template Designer and Web Editor
Strong knowledge in generating Interactive communications (Draft Editor, Data Capture)
Good knowledge of Thunderhead/Smart Communication API's
Should be well versed with preparation of the XML data schema and their mappting to business data objects
Requirements Definition Development and developing business templates sa per business requirements
Consolidating form templates, recognizing common graphical elements, information blocks, layouts, variable data requirements, funcational similarity and multilingual
Strong understanding of SmartCOMM/Thunderhead concepts & developmentSound knowledge of SmartCOMM (Thunderhead) Suites of Products - Advanced Template Designer (Business Content Studio and Admin), Data Modeller (Business Object Studio)

Education & Experience Required
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or related IT field.
Four or more years of SmartCOMM programming experience or related work experience
Experience and understanding of multiple programming languages and applicable applications
Or an equivalent combination of education and experience
Principal Duties & Responsibilities
Contributes to the development effort by participating in workshops, speaking about technical solutions, builds prototypes and takes on coding assignments
Translates simple to moderately complex user stories into functional and actionable software within the IT environment
Collaborates on and informs cross-functional teams of new feature technical design, technical requirements, limitations, and implementation
Performs unit testing, integration testing, and performance testing of new product functionality; analyzes and mitigates issues identified during testing
Actively participates in meetings with representatives from multiple business and/or IT units
